Aggregate raster or vector data
Layers representing colors
Active category
Add (in place) a SpatRaster to another SpatRaster object or to a SpatRasterDataset or SpatRasterCollection
SpatRaster or SpatVector to data.frame
Compare two SpatRasters for equality
Coerce to a "raster" object
Animate a SpatRaster
Cartogram
Adjacent cells
Combine SpatRaster or SpatVector objects
Align a SpatExtent
Coerce a Spat* object to a list
Classify (or reclassify) cell values
Bar plot of a SpatRaster
Arithmetic
Conversion to a SpatVector of lines
Query by clicking on a map
Convex hull, minimal bounding rotated rectangle, and minimal bounding circle
Compare and logical methods
Box plot of SpatRaster data
Detect boundaries (edges)
Check for longitude/latitude crs
Cost distance
clamp time series data
Get cell numbers
Class "SpatExtent"
Centroids
Create a buffer around vector geometries or raster patches
Conversion to a SpatVector of polygons
Combine geometries
Density plot
Color table
deprecated methods
SpatRaster class
Create a text representation of (the skeleton of) an object
Direction
Conversion to a SpatVector of points
Clamp values
Names of Spat* objects
Replace values with values from another object
Focal values
Create, get or set a SpatExtent
Disaggregate raster cells or vector geometries
Make a VRT header file
Compare geometries of SpatRasters
Draw a polygon, line, extent, or points
Scatterplot of two SpatRaster layers
Data type of a SpatRaster or SpatVector
Factors to numeric
Apply a function to the cells of a SpatRaster
Make a dot-density map
Cross-tabulate
Plot a graticule
Estimate values for cell values that are NA
by interpolating between layers
Focal function across two layers
Rasterize geometric properties of vector data
Transfer values of a SpatRaster to another one with a different geometry
Focal regression
Extend
Check or fix polygon or extent validity
Impose the geometry of a SpatRaster to those in a SpatRasterCollection.
North arrow
normalize vector data that crosses the dateline
SpatRaster image method
Sieve filter
Plot a SpatExtent
Cut out a geographic subset
Deep copy
Vector topology methods
Compute focal values with an iterating C++ function
Get or compute the minimum and maximum cell values
Add additional nodes to lines or polygons
Erase parts of a SpatVector object
Two argument arc-tangent
Get focal values
Get the expanse (area) of individual polygons or for all (summed) raster cells
Area covered by each raster cell
Concatenate categorical rasters
tighten SpatRaster or SpatRasterDataset objects
Spatial autocorrelation
Coercion to vector, matrix or array
Geographic distance
Correlation and (weighted) covariance
Dimensions of a SpatRaster or SpatVector and related objects
Get the coordinates of SpatVector geometries or SpatRaster cells
Replace values of a SpatRaster
Find gaps between polygons
Contour plot
Rasterize points with a moving window
simplifyGeom geometries
Get or set a coordinate reference system
Trim a SpatRaster
depth of SpatRaster layers
Lagged differences
Quantiles of spatial data
Intersection
Fill time gaps in a SpatRaster
describe
meta
Add halo-ed text to a plot
Replace with $<-
Pairs plot (matrix of scatterplots)
Frequency table
Subset a SpatRaster or a SpatVector
Rectify a SpatRaster
Extract values from a SpatRaster
summary
elongate lines
Make an inset map
Check for rotation
Scale (gain) and offset
global statistics
Geometry type of a SpatVector
extract values along lines
GDAL version, supported file formats, and cache size
wrap and unwrap
head and tail of a SpatRaster or SpatVector
Interpolate points using a moving window
Flip or reverse a raster
Spatial relationships between geometries
Set or get metadata
Categorical rasters
Linear units of the coordinate reference system
Remove holes from polygons
Three-dimensional focal values
Mask values in a SpatRaster or SpatVector
Union SpatVector or SpatExtent objects
time of SpatRaster layers
Make a map
Where are the cells with the min or max values?
Raster value types
Create a graticule
Focal weights matrix
Cell level regression
Which cells are TRUE?
force counter-clockwise polygons
Make tiles
Summarize
merge SpatRasters by timelines to create a single timeseries
Value matching for SpatRasters
Distance on a grid
Query a SpatVectorProxy object
Rotate data along longitude
scale bar
spin a SpatVector
replace cell values
SpatRaster wrap with caching options
Initialize a SpatRaster with values
Nearest neighbor interpolation
Shared paths
Scale values
add a custom legend
Change values in-place
variable and long variable names
Get the geometry (coordinates) of a SpatVector
Change the coordinate reference system
Add points, lines, or polygons to a map
Split
Set the values of raster cells or of geometry attributes
Unique values
ifelse for SpatRasters
Merge SpatRasters, or merge a SpatVector with a data.frame
Histogram
units of SpatRaster or SpatRasterDataSet
Replicate layers
Select the values of a range of layers, as specified by cell values in another SpatRaster
Check if a SpatExtent or SpatVector is empty
segregate
Apply a function to layers of a SpatRaster, or sub-datasets of a SpatRasterDataset
Spatial interpolation
Detect patches (clumps) of cells
map.pal arrow
mosaic SpatRasters
Spatial selection
Change values in a file
is not NA
Map panel
Shift
General mathematical methods
modal value
Range-apply
Find and remove geometries that are NA
SpatVector geometric properties
Memory available and needed
Create SpatVector objects
Set a window
Origin
Create a SpatRaster
Extract values from a SpatRaster, SpatVector or SpatExtent
Perimeter or length
Compare coordinate reference systems
Combine row, column, and layer numbers
Symmetrical difference
Zonal statistics
Red-Green-Blue plot of a multi-layered SpatRaster
nearby geometries
Spatial model predictions
Zoom in on a map
Rasterize vector data
Replace layers or variables
Compute a viewshed
Fill layers with a range
Create a SpatRasterDataset
Perspective plot
rescale
Options
Write raster data to a file
select cells with high or low values
Take a regular sample
Apply a terra function that takes only a single layer and returns a SpatRaster to all layers of a SpatRaster
Virtual Raster Dataset
Rolling (moving) functions
Subset a SpatRaster or a SpatVector
Hill shading
Create a SpatRasterCollection
Stretch
Plot with leaflet
Apply a function to subsets of layers of a SpatRaster
Voronoi diagram and Delaunay triangles
Subset a SpatRaster or a SpatVector
saveRDS and serialize for SpatVector and SpatRaster*
Write raster data to a NetCDF file
Description of the methods in the terra package
terrain characteristics
Add labels to a map
Temporary files
Read from, or write to, file
List or remove layers from a vector file
Coordinates from a row, column or cell number and vice versa
Data sources of a SpatRaster
Transpose
Sort a SpatRaster or SpatVector
filenames of VRT tiles
Write SpatVector data to a file
Create a SpatVectorCollection
Get or set single values of an extent
Cell values and geometry attributes
Weighted mean of layers
Set the NA flag
Class "SpatVector"